Halo Comic Announcement

Our good friends at Marvel made a couple of nifty announcements regarding the upcoming (and as-yet, untitled) Halo comic series, and although they haven't set a date yet, they did reveal that the artist and writer paired for the project are Alex Maleev and Brian Bendis, respectively.
Their work on Marvel projects including Daredevil and Ultimate Spider-Man has made them comic book legends, and Bungie is proud to be working with such a talented team.
